Aptitude mistake taxonomy

Classify the mistake before deciding how to fix it

Different error types require different improvements. More practice alone may not solve poor reading, ineffective pacing, weak question selection, or technical-delivery problems.

T01
Understanding mistakes

Misreading the instruction, condition, wording, unit, diagram, or required output

These mistakes occur when the candidate knows the concept but solves a different problem from the one actually presented.

Correction: highlight conditions, negatives, units, ranges, and the exact requested value.
T02
Method mistakes

Selecting a longer, unsuitable, memorized, or poorly understood approach

A correct concept may still lead to slow or fragile execution when the candidate chooses an inefficient method or applies a shortcut outside its valid conditions.

Correction: compare alternative methods and record where each shortcut is valid.
T03
Execution mistakes

Making arithmetic, transcription, sign, option-selection, or rough-work errors

These errors often appear avoidable but may reveal unstable calculation habits, crowded rough work, rushed reading, or inadequate checking.

Correction: use clear working, estimate the likely answer, and verify the final option.
T04
Strategy mistakes

Spending time on the wrong questions, guessing poorly, or leaving no review window

Aptitude tests often require disciplined selection and pacing in addition to conceptual ability.

Correction: use time checkpoints, skip rules, elimination, and a planned final review.

Twelve common aptitude-test mistakes

Identify the behaviour, consequence, and practical correction

Review mistakes at the level of individual questions and across the complete attempt. The same final score can result from very different error patterns.

Mistake

Starting without reading the complete instructions

Candidates may miss section timing, question navigation, calculator availability, negative marking, submission rules, permitted resources, or whether questions can be revisited.

01
Correction

Read the instructions first and convert important rules into a simple attempt plan.

Mistake

Attempting questions strictly in the displayed order

A difficult early question can consume time that could have been used to secure several easier marks elsewhere.

02
Correction

Use an initial scan or first pass to identify clear, high-confidence questions.

Mistake

Spending too long trying to rescue one difficult item

Candidates may continue because they have already invested time, even when the expected return is low.

03
Correction

Define a maximum first-pass time and mark unresolved questions for later review.

Mistake

Reading quickly but missing qualifiers and negative wording

Words such as not, except, minimum, maximum, approximately, always, or cannot may completely change the required answer.

04
Correction

Pause on qualifiers and restate the question in a shorter form before solving.

Mistake

Ignoring units, scale, labels, and conversion requirements

A calculation can be numerically correct but still produce the wrong option because the answer requires a different unit or scale.

05
Correction

Write the required unit beside the target value and convert only with a documented step.

Mistake

Performing detailed calculations before estimating the answer

Without estimation, candidates may fail to notice a decimal, sign, percentage, or order-of-magnitude error.

06
Correction

Estimate the expected range before calculating and compare the final answer with that range.

Mistake

Applying memorized shortcuts without checking their conditions

Shortcuts can fail when assumptions, ratios, signs, averages, sequence rules, or percentage bases differ from the familiar pattern.

07
Correction

Learn why a shortcut works and identify the conditions required before applying it.

Mistake

Guessing randomly without considering negative marking

Uncontrolled guessing can reduce the final result when incorrect responses carry a penalty.

08
Correction

Use elimination and follow an attempt rule based on the actual scoring policy.

Mistake

Keeping disorganized rough work

Crowded calculations make it difficult to identify assumptions, reuse intermediate values, or check signs and copied numbers.

09
Correction

Label each question and keep one calculation chain in one clearly separated area.

Mistake

Solving correctly but selecting or submitting the wrong option

Candidates may click a neighbouring option, forget a conversion, or fail to save the intended response.

10
Correction

Re-read the required output and verify the selected option before moving forward.

Mistake

Using the entire test time without preserving a review window

Candidates lose the opportunity to correct unanswered items, accidental selections, unit errors, or questions marked for review.

11
Correction

Reserve a final review block and use section checkpoints to protect it.

Mistake

Reviewing only the score after practice

The score does not explain whether errors came from concepts, interpretation, method choice, calculation, pacing, or technology.

12
Correction

Maintain an error log with mistake type, cause, correction, and retest date.

Question-type trap atlas

Different aptitude sections create different mistake patterns

Review section-specific traps while maintaining consistent habits for instructions, units, timing, elimination, rough work, and final review.

01 Percentages and profit Quantitative
Frequent error pattern

Using the wrong percentage base or combining percentage changes incorrectly

Percentage questions often depend on identifying the original reference value rather than applying a memorized calculation.

Common trap Treating equal percentage increase and decrease as cancelling.
Better control Write the percentage base and test the result with a simple reference value.
02 Ratios and averages Quantitative
Frequent error pattern

Reversing the ratio, averaging averages directly, or losing the total quantity

Ratio and average questions require careful tracking of order, weights, totals, and the population represented by each value.

Common trap Adding or averaging ratios without converting them to comparable quantities.
Better control Define what each part represents before performing operations.
03 Data interpretation Numerical
Frequent error pattern

Reading the wrong row, column, axis, legend, period, unit, or scale

Data-interpretation mistakes often arise before calculation begins because the candidate extracts the wrong values.

Common trap Comparing values with different units or time periods.
Better control Confirm title, labels, unit, scale, and requested period before copying data.
04 Sequences and patterns Logical
Frequent error pattern

Committing to the first plausible pattern without testing alternatives

A short sequence may support more than one apparent pattern until the complete relationship is checked.

Common trap Applying one operation repeatedly when the pattern alternates.
Better control Test differences, ratios, positions, alternating rules, and grouping.
05 Arrangements and deductions Logical
Frequent error pattern

Treating a possible arrangement as the only valid arrangement

Logical deductions should distinguish what must be true, may be true, and cannot be true.

Common trap Making an unstated assumption to complete the arrangement.
Better control Label fixed constraints separately from derived possibilities.
06 Verbal reasoning Verbal
Frequent error pattern

Selecting an option that sounds reasonable but is not supported by the text

Verbal reasoning often measures evidence from the passage rather than general knowledge or personal agreement.

Common trap Strengthening the author’s claim beyond what was actually stated.
Better control Identify the exact sentence or implication supporting the selected option.

Three-pass attempt strategy

Reduce time-management mistakes by giving every pass a clear purpose

The exact strategy should reflect the assessment rules, section structure, negative marking, navigation, question difficulty, and individual strengths.

01 First pass

Secure clear and high-confidence questions

Begin with questions that can be understood and solved using a familiar method within the planned time budget.

Attempt Clear questions with known methods and manageable calculations.
Skip Questions with unclear interpretation, long setup, or uncertain method.
Mark Questions that appear solvable but require more time.
Avoid Continuing only because time has already been invested.
02 Second pass

Return to medium-difficulty and partially solved questions

Use the remaining working time on questions with a reasonable probability of completion and useful elimination.

Prioritize Questions where the setup, formula, or logical structure is already clear.
Eliminate Remove impossible options before performing full calculations.
Estimate Use ranges, signs, scale, and approximate values where appropriate.
Exit Leave the question when progress remains weak after the time limit.
03 Final pass

Review unanswered, marked, and high-risk responses

Protect time for checking mistakes that can be corrected quickly without reopening every completed solution.

Check Negative wording, units, signs, conversions, and requested values.
Confirm Selected options, unanswered questions, and saved responses.
Revisit Questions where one more step or elimination may produce an answer.
Submit Follow the scoring and submission rules without last-second random changes.

Post-test learning loop

Turn every practice attempt into a targeted improvement plan

Repeating full tests without analyzing the causes of mistakes may reinforce weak methods, poor pacing, and careless habits.

L01
Record

Capture every incorrect, skipped, guessed, and unusually slow question

Record the question type, time used, selected method, confidence, final result, and whether the answer was changed.

Output: complete attempt-error register.
L02
Classify

Identify whether the cause was concept, reading, method, calculation, pacing, or technology

Avoid classifying every wrong answer as a weak topic. The same topic may contain several different error causes.

Output: mistake categories and repeated patterns.
L03
Correct

Write the correct method and the control that would have prevented the mistake

Controls may include marking a unit, estimating a range, setting a skip limit, rewriting a ratio, drawing a table, or testing an alternative.

Output: practical correction rule for each mistake type.
L04
Retest

Solve comparable questions after a delay and verify that the behaviour changed

Improvement should appear in method selection, accuracy, time, confidence, and the ability to explain why the correction works.

Output: evidence that the mistake pattern has reduced.

Aptitude assessment team mistakes

Assessment design and delivery can also create misleading results

Candidate performance should be interpreted only after reviewing question quality, instructions, timing, scoring, accessibility, technology, support, and reporting.

01 Unclear questions Content
Assessment-design mistake

Using ambiguous wording, incomplete conditions, weak distractors, or multiple defensible answers

A question should distinguish relevant aptitude rather than reward guessing what the author intended.

Correction: use independent content review, representative pilots, candidate feedback, and documented defect handling.
02 Poor time design Duration
Assessment-design mistake

Selecting time limits without considering reading, navigation, accessibility, and question difficulty

Excessively restrictive timing may measure familiarity with the format or delivery conditions rather than the intended aptitude.

Correction: pilot realistic participants and review time distributions by section, question type, and supported conditions.
03 Score-only reporting Evidence
Assessment-design mistake

Reporting one overall score without competency, section, timing, incident, or limitation context

Similar total scores may represent different strengths, weaknesses, completion patterns, and delivery conditions.

Correction: provide section evidence, competency results, completion status, incidents, limitations, and decision guidance.
04 Ignoring delivery barriers Experience
Assessment-design mistake

Treating browser, device, connectivity, accessibility, authentication, or support failures as candidate weakness

Technical and accessibility incidents may affect participation, timing, completion, and response quality.

Correction: test supported environments, provide practice and support, record incidents, and review affected results.

Frequently asked questions

Common Mistakes in Aptitude Tests FAQs

Review common questions about instructions, timing, accuracy, guessing, negative marking, shortcuts, question selection, practice analysis, online-test readiness, and assessment quality.

What are the most common mistakes in aptitude tests?

Common mistakes include ignoring instructions, attempting every question in order, spending too long on difficult items, misreading conditions, missing units, using the wrong percentage base, applying shortcuts incorrectly, guessing randomly, keeping unclear rough work, selecting the wrong option, and leaving no review time.

How can I reduce careless mistakes in aptitude tests?

Mark important conditions, write units, estimate the expected answer, keep labelled rough work, verify copied values, check the selected option, and analyze repeated careless-error patterns after practice.

Why is time management important in aptitude tests?

Time management helps candidates secure easier questions, prevent one difficult item from consuming excessive time, preserve a review window, and balance accuracy with the number of attempted questions.

Should aptitude-test questions be attempted in order?

The best approach depends on navigation rules and section design. Where questions can be revisited, candidates may benefit from attempting clear, high-confidence items first and returning to more time-consuming questions later.

How should negative marking affect guessing?

Review the actual scoring rule before deciding whether to guess. Random guessing may be unsuitable where incorrect answers carry a penalty, while elimination may improve the decision when one or more options can be ruled out.

Are aptitude-test shortcuts always useful?

Shortcuts are useful only when their assumptions and valid conditions are understood. A memorized shortcut applied to a different percentage base, ratio direction, sequence rule, or data condition can produce a fast but incorrect answer.

How can I improve calculation accuracy?

Estimate the expected range, write intermediate values clearly, separate questions in rough work, track signs and decimal places, verify percentage bases, and compare the final value with the available options and required unit.

Why do candidates make mistakes in data-interpretation questions?

Common causes include reading the wrong row or column, ignoring the title or legend, missing units, using the wrong period, confusing absolute values with percentages, and calculating before confirming the correct source data.

What should be reviewed after an aptitude practice test?

Review incorrect, skipped, guessed, changed, and unusually slow questions. Classify each issue as a concept, interpretation, method, calculation, pacing, selection, or technical-delivery problem.

How should candidates prepare for an online aptitude test?

Check the supported device, browser, internet connection, authentication process, calculator rules, practice environment, navigation, saving, permitted resources, proctoring, accessibility options, and technical-support process.

Can a low aptitude-test score result from technical problems?

Technical incidents involving authentication, connectivity, browser behaviour, saving, navigation, device compatibility, or accessibility may affect timing, completion, and response quality and should be reviewed when relevant.

Should aptitude-test scores be used as the only hiring decision?

Aptitude-test results should generally be interpreted with role relevance, assessment conditions, competency evidence, structured interviews, work history, technical or job-specific assessments, and qualified human judgement.
